  • Bean soup with tomato (Sopa de feijão com tomate)

    • alysekstokes on March 23, 2026

      This is a really soul-warming and tasty soup. I made a few modifications to the method: - Used some cooked Rancho Gordo Domingo rojo beans I had in the freezer and, after thawing, pureed half of them with their liquid (and the extra water specified) in my Vitamix instead of using a food mill. - I simply cored and chopped my tomato; peeling felt like a bridge too far for a weeknight dinner. Otherwise I stuck to the recipe and was so pleased with the results. This is hearty but not heavy—ideal for a cool early spring day!

  • Chicken pies (Empadas de galinha)

    • mcvl on May 26, 2011

      Wednesday, 25 May 2011 Delicious empanada (empada in Portuguese) filling. I was starting with already cooked chicken, so steeped the meat rather than simmering it. I used the half-white-wine, half-white-wine-vinegar option. The filling seemed a touch dry, so I used some of the broth and some other chicken broth I had on hand to make a regular flour-based gravy to serve on top. For the pastry cases, I used Anya von Bremzen's Olive Oil & Saffron Pastry from The New Spanish Table, one of my favorite doughs of all time. Very, very well received -- anything in a pastry case is a big hit in my house, but this was really special.

Publishers Text

The Mediterranean diet is famed for its fresh and vibrant cuisine. In this book, Ana Patuleia Ortins invites you to discover or revisit the soul-comforting, peasant food of Portugal, just as vibrant, yet distinct from that of its neighbors. Peppered with a lifetime of anecdotes from a passionate cook, Portuguese Home Cooking draws us into an immigrant kitchen where traditional culinary methods were handed down from father to daughter, shared and refined with the help of the family and friends who watched, chopped, and tasted.

The recipes in this cookbook are of dishes prepared as they are in Portugal with the measurements tried and tested, and the ingredients and methods fully explained. With warmth and gusto, Ana Patuleia Ortins shares garden-fresh salads, hearty wine and garlic braises, legumes and leafy greens, meat and shellfish dishes, rustic breads, and the luscious desserts for which Portugal is known. Beautiful food and location photography will transport you to Portugal's picturesque countryside, and novices and experienced chefs alike will delight in the culture and cuisine, whether nostalgic for home, or discovering it for the first time.
